Everyone desires and needs a safe and secure and comfortable location to live. Lots of house repairs may be achieved over the course of a weekend. However, there are some DIY fixes that need to not be tried. A damaged, dripping roof is among the most feared home repairs because finding and correcting a leak isn’t usually straightforward.
Tarnished or drooping sheetrock, flaking paint, or an apparent drip are all signs of a roof leak. Even a small undiscovered leak can cause damaged insulation, mildew development, and decayed wood structure. A leak can also move and spread out from the initial broken region to another portion of your residential or commercial property.

Flat Roofs
Flat roofings are a great way to keep a structure safe from water. Knowing exactly what to do with a flat roofing will guarantee you have a working roofing system that will last a long time.
They may look great, and are really common, flat roofings do need routine maintenance and in-depth repair in order to efficiently avoid water seepage. You'll be pleased with your flat roofing system for a really long time if this is done properly.
Flat roofing systems aren't as popular and/or glamorous as its newer equivalents, such as slate, tile, or copper roofing systems. However, they are simply as essential and need much more attention. In order to avoid discarding cash on short-term repair work, you should understand exactly how flat roof systems are designed, the various types of flat roofings that are offered, and the value of routine assessment and upkeep.
A flat roofing system works by offering a waterproof membrane over a structure. It consists of one or more layers of hydrophobic products that is placed over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is typically placed in between the roofing system and the deck membrane.
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, converge with the membrane and the other building elements to prevent water seepage. The water is then directed to drains, downspouts, and rain gutters by the roofing system's minor pitch.
There are 4 most typical types of flat roofing systems. Noted in order of increasing sturdiness and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, built-up or multiple-ply,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roof that is applied over and existing roofing, to $20 per square foot or more for brand-new metal roofs.
Used given that the 1890s, asphalt roll roof normally consists of one layer of asphalt-saturated natural or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roofing system fel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and generally covered with a granular mineral surface. The seams are normally covered over with a roof substance. It can last about 10 years.
Single-ply membrane roof is the latest kind of roof product. It is often used to replace multiple-ply roofings. 10 to 12 year guarantees are typical, but correct installation is important and upkeep is still required.
Built-up or multiple-ply roofing, likewise referred to as B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or coated felts or mats that are sprinkled with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roof tile, ballast, or sheet pavers that are utilized to safeguard the hidden materials from the weather condition. BURs are created to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the products utilized.
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a finish of asphalt or coal tar. Since the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es examining and keeping the seams of the roof tough.
Flat-seamed roofs have actually been utilized because the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last lots of years depending on the quality of the direct exposure, product, and upkeep to the aspects.
Galvanized metal does require regular painting in order to avoid corrosion and split joints require to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and typically requires repl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less-steel are preferred as long-lasting flat roofing systems.
